The remuneration of membership servers can range extensively primarily based on components similar to location, kind of firm, and expertise stage. According to latest reports, the median hourly wage for meals and beverage servers in the U.S. hovers around $12 to $15, not including suggestions. In upscale venues or personal golf equipment, servers can earn significantly more, enhancing their earnings through ideas that often exceed the base wage. For instance, a server working in a high-end institution may take house over $50,000 yearly when contemplating each hourly wages and gratuities. Its important to contemplate that earnings also can fluctuate based mostly on the time of yr, with busier seasons yielding greater incomes as extra visitors frequent institutions during holidays and special events.
